AUTO SHOP FIRE FOLO-PKG


It's not the kind of wake up call denney rush was expecting.

Sot denney rush, pro-tech automotive services manager "230 in the morning to get that kind of phone call- I was in shock."

A fire had ignited at pro tech automotive services.

Sot denney

" my first concern when I got the call was is my building okay and is my dog alright."

The 8 year old pit bull got firefighters attention, Then ran to the back of the building to get away from the smoke.

Not as easy feat for a dog they call 'baby'

Sot denney

" She lost her leg the first part of the year- and one this."

But babys eyes weren't the only ones watching the flames.

This surveillance camera recorded the engine of a 2005 Mercedes Benz spark.

Then cause a fire that engulfed 4 vehicles, burned another and caused damage to the building.

Sot denney

"it's caught on cam and it helps the police take care of the business."

The fire marshal has deemed the fire an accident, Caused by an electoral problem in the cars engine.

an electrical problem is why the benz was at the shop in the first place.

Sot denney

" the battery light kept coming on and that kept killing the car."

We checked with Mercedes benz, who told us there are no recalls relating to electrical fires in the c series.

But anyone with concerns- can contact their local dealer for an inspection.

All these cars- belong to local dealers- now stuck waiting for insurance claims to process.

Sot denney

There's about $70,000 in damage to these vehicles and then we had some damage to the building. But baby's okay."

Okay- and loving the extra attention.

Sot denney

"She's more than a pet she's a family member to us."

In fm Jp. Return to index of stories...

FIRST ALERT FORECAST-WXWALL


THIS WEATHERCAST HAS BEEN PREPARED BY THE NBC2 WEATHER STAFF.

IT IS NOT A VERBATIM OF WHAT IS BEING SAID, BUT IS THE FORECAST FOR OUR AREA.

The upcoming hours and days may end up being pretty interesting for us in the world of weather across Southwest Florida.

Our eyes are focused on two weather systems, a front to our northwest and a tropical system to our southeast.

Let's first discuss the front that's moving into Central Florida today since it's more of an immediate weather changer. On the radar this afternoon, we're tracking a band of showers and thunderstorms across Central Florida that stretches well out into the Gulf of Mexico. This rain is spreading south, and we could very well see some of this make it to parts of Southwest Florida by this evening or tonight. There's still some uncertainty as to how much rain will survive the journey down the peninsula and precisely when it will move in. The best estimate would place the storms over northern portions of the viewing area by 7-9 p.m. If the storms hold on to enough steam, we may see some of the storms move into central and southern portions of the viewing area around or beyond sunset. Some of these storms could be capable of producing heavy rain, gusty winds and frequent lightning.

The next item of interest is a tropical system in the western Atlantic that may have an impact on our long-range forecast. Tropical Depression Nine formed earlier this morning, and the storm may become Tropical Storm Isaac later today. T.D. Nine is still roughly two thousand miles away from Southwest Florida, but it's quickly moving toward the Lesser Antilles and should arrive there Wednesday night. Forecast models continue to strengthen the system Thursday and Friday, and it could potentially develop into a Category 1 hurricane by then. One of the keys in determining how strong the storm will get is its interaction with Cuba and Hispaniola, where 10,000 foot mountains have been known to rip hurricanes apart. The system's interaction with Cuba and Hispaniola will be critical in determining its strength, and just a change of 50 miles could make all the difference. It's just too early to resolve the finer details at this point.

The bottom line is T.D. Nine will be a storm to watch closely for anyone in South Florida, and IF this storm were to affect our weather, it would most likely be early next week around Monday or Tuesday. Return to index of stories...


CLARION HOTEL SALE-ON CAM


A LONG TIME LEE COUNTY HOTEL AND WATERING HOLE IS OFFICIALLY CLOSED.

SO WHAT'S NEXT FOR THE OLD CLARION HOTEL PROPERTY ALONG HIGHWAY 41 NEAR COLLEGE PARKWAY?

NBC2'S LAUREN DISPIRITO SPOKE EXCLUSIVELY WITH DEVELOPERS WHO BOUGHT THE PROPERTY. Return to index of stories...


CLARION HOTEL SALE-PKG


nats cars drive by

IF YOU'VE SPENT ANY TIME CRUISING DOWN HIGHWAY 41 IN LEE COUNTY, YOU'VE PROBABLY SEEN IT--

the clarion had the best cheeseburgers in town

--A POPULAR HANGOUT TIMOTHY MULLINS SAYS HE'LL MISS.

THE CLARION HOTEL, IT'S RESTAURANTS AND TIKI BAR, SHUT THE DOORS FOR GOOD--

AS LEE COUNTY-BASED DEVELOPERS CLOSED A THREE POINT THREE MILLION DOLLAR DEAL.

turn this, really a blighted area, into a real thriving and job producing environment

DAN CREIGHTON IS ONE OF FOUR INVESTORS WHO PARTNERED TO BUY THE 5 POINT 6 ACRE, BANK OWNED, PROPERTY.

compared to all the other nicer hotels you could stay in the area that are up to date with new amenities this one definitely wasn't one of those

HE HOPES IT SOON COULD BE.

ACCORDING TO CREIGHTON, THEY'RE LOOKING AT KEEPING THE 87-ROOM HOTEL TOWER, BUT BRINGING IN A NEW CHAIN TO RUN IT.

THEN, THEY MAY DEMOLISH THE REST, TO MAKE ROOM FOR NEW BUSINESS.

we're looking for great retail establishments made up of restaurants banks large retail users something that's really gonna add to our community

CREIGHTON DEVELOPMENT IS THE SAME GROUP THAT'S WRAPPING UP CONSTRUCTION ACROSS THE STREET, AT HIGHWAY 41 AND COLLEGE PARKWAY.

business generates business, and this is gonna be good for all the surrounding businesses

HE SAYS THE TRAFFIC, SOMETIMES MORE THAN 100 THOUSAND CARS EACH DAY, MAKES HIM CONFIDENT NEW RETAIL CAN SUCCEED.

it brings a lot of money into the economy and all that

MULLIN SAYS HE'LL FIND A NEW HANGOUT, AND HOPES DEVELOPMENT HERE IMPROVES HIS NEIGHBORHOOD.

IN LEE COUNTY, LAUREN DISPIRITO, NBC2. Return to index of stories...


RADIATION THERAPY-VO WIPE


RESEARCHERS ARE TESTING PROMISING NEW RADIATION THERAPY, THAT COULD HELP BREAST CANCER PATIENTS.

IT'S CALLED THE ACCU-BOOST SYSTEM.

IT DELIVERS RADIATION TO TREAT BREAST CANCER - BUT IN A NEW WAY.

IT ONLY TREATS THE PORTION OF THE BREAST WHERE THE CANCER IS LOCATED.

THAT RADIATION IS DELIVERED THROUGH CATHETER LIKE WIRES. Return to index of stories...


RADIATION THERAPY-SOTVO


"With this approach we actually immobilize the breast by compressing it gently and image the breast for each and every treatment. That's how we're able to see the lumpectomy cavity and target it very precisely for each treatment."

DOCTORS SAY THE ACCUBOOST SYSTEM IS *NON* INVASIVE - BECAUSE NOTHING IS PLACED INSIDE THE BREAST.

THERE'S ALSO NO RISK FOR INFECTION.

TESTS ARE TAKING PLACE RIGHT NOW IN NEW YORK AND MIAMI. Return to index of stories...
